    To leiamoody and others complaining of the lack of reviews: it's probably not the best way to say this, but I'm kind of relieved to see people that I know are talented are also a bit discouraged with the lack of reviews here. It really seems to be an overall trend, though it hits the non-L/M fics the hardest. I'm lucky enough to have picked up a regular reviewer and some (apparently, though who can tell?) repeat readers, but like pretty much everyone here would like more positive reinforcement. Of course, that's something that you have to take into account when writing OC fic; it's never going to be the most popular. The double curse of unfamiliar characters and the overhanging spectre of Mary Sue. I decided to write an OC fic anyway because that's the story that holds my interest as a writer. That and I have trouble finding the voice of canon characters, always worrying that I'll get them wrong. With original characters, I feel like there is more room for exploration.
